Neighborhood Overview
Foley, Alabama, is situated in Baldwin County, a rapidly growing area in the southern part of the state, just a short drive from the Gulf Coast beaches. The Foley Sports Complex is located on the west side of the city, easily accessible from main thoroughfares. Proximity to Mobile Bay and the Florida Panhandle makes it a popular destination for regional events. Major access routes include Interstate 10 and U.S. Highway 98, which connect Foley to larger cities like Mobile and Pensacola. Driving times from the nearest major airport, Pensacola International Airport (PNS), typically range from 45 to 60 minutes, depending on traffic. For those arriving from further afield, Mobile Regional Airport (MOB) is also an option, though slightly further. The city itself is designed for automotive convenience, with ample parking available at most venues and attractions. Rideshare services are generally available, especially during major events, though their availability can vary. Planning your arrival to account for potential event traffic, especially during peak tournament weekends, is highly recommended. Aim to arrive at least 30-45 minutes prior to scheduled game times to allow for parking and navigating the complex.

Local Tips
Expect significant traffic on Highway 59: , especially during peak tourist seasons and major sporting events.
Local restaurants can experience long wait times on Friday and Saturday evenings: consider reservations or off-peak dining.
Stay hydrated and use sunscreen: the Alabama heat and humidity are significant factors during warmer months.
Seasonal note: Foley experiences a distinct seasonal rhythm. Spring and fall are ideal for sports tournaments, with pleasant temperatures perfect for outdoor competition. Summer brings heat and humidity, making indoor activities or beach trips a welcome respite. Winters are mild, though cool enough for sweaters, and can sometimes be damp. The area sees peak visitor numbers during spring break, summer vacation, and major holiday weekends, which can impact traffic and accommodation availability. Event organizers strategically schedule tournaments to take advantage of the most favorable weather conditions.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Foley is generally mild, with average temperatures in the 50s and 60s Fahrenheit. While days can be pleasant, evenings can turn cool, so packing layers, including a light jacket or sweater, is advisable. Outdoor events are usually comfortable, but occasional cold fronts or rain showers can occur, necessitating rain gear and warmer attire for spectators.
Spring & early summer
Spring offers warm and increasingly humid conditions, with temperatures climbing into the 70s and 80s. Early summer continues this trend, bringing sunshine ideal for outdoor sports but also increasing humidity. Light, breathable clothing is recommended. Sunscreen, hats, and sunglasses are essential for extended periods outdoors at the complex.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er in Foley is characterized by hot and very humid weather, with temperatures frequently reaching the 90s. Afternoon thunderstorms are common and can be intense, leading to potential delays for outdoor events. Staying hydrated is critical, and seeking shade or indoor breaks during the hottest parts of the day is highly recommended for players and spectators.
Fall season
Fall brings relief from summer heat, with temperatures gradually cooling into the 70s and 60s. Humidity levels decrease, making it a prime season for outdoor sports. The weather is generally pleasant and stable, though occasional tropical systems from the Gulf can bring rain and wind. Layers are still a good idea as temperatures can fluctuate.
Rain & snow
Rain is common throughout the year in Foley, especially during the summer thunderstorm season and occasional winter fronts. Snow is extremely rare and typically doesn't accumulate. When rain is expected, participants and spectators should come prepared with umbrellas, ponchos, and waterproof footwear. Event schedules may be adjusted for significant weather events, so staying updated with organizers is wise.
